Owing to the advances in satellite manufacturing and rocket launch technology, the deployment of mega LEO constellations has become an important direction for the development of satellite Internet. Compared with traditional LEO constellations, new mega constellations, characterized by multi-orbit hybrid networking and stratified integration of satellites at different altitudes, exhibit new features such as a greater number of nodes and more dynamic topology. In light of these features, this paper first summarized the challenges of mega LEO constellations networking from five aspects: constellation design, protocol integration, topology representation, routing algorithms, and network simulation. It then introduced the key technologies for mega constellation networking, included network architecture, protocol design, network addressing, inter-satellite link establishment, and fault recovery, and provided outlooks on their development directions, aimed to offer references for the construction of Chinese satellite Internet.
